AP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

h5开发app示例下载

HTML5开发移动应用是近年来的一个热门话题。HTML5的出现标志着Web技术和移动设备的融合,Web应用可以像原生应用一样提供很好的用户体验,因此业内也把HTML5称作“移动互联网新一代技术”。在本文中,我们将探讨HTML5开发移动应用的原理,并为大家提供一些示例下载。

#### 何为HTML5移动应用?

HTML5移动应用,是一种基于HTML5的移动应用形态,实现在移动设备上的展示。HTML5技术用于移动设备应用开发,无需额外安装任何平台,只要支持HTML5的浏览器即可实现。HTML5应用具有跨平台特性,通过一套代码就可以在各种终端运行,同时具有离线运行、交互性突出等特点。

#### HTML5移动应用的优势

1.跨平台性。一套代码可以在各个平台上运行,很大程度上缩短开发周期。

2.节省时间和成本。使用HTML5技术进行应用开发可以省去部署和维护的麻烦,同时不需要购买开发人员的专门开发设备。

3. 支持应用离线运行,保证了应用的稳定性和可靠性。

4. 支持Web标准和Web服务等,丰富的扩展性和超强的可移植性,保证了应用发展的趋势。

#### HTML5移动应用的实现示例

1. 淘宝手机客户端

淘宝手机客户端是一款基于HTML5的应用。该应用实现了移动购物、物流查询、团购打折、二手交易、收藏、极速退款等各方面的功能。

![taobao](https://i.loli.net/2021/07/19/dSt4fG6KrA3I5aR.png)

2. 大众点评

大众点评是一款基于HTML5的应用。该应用实现了餐饮、娱乐、生活购物、旅游、周边出行等各方面的功能。

![dianping](https://i.loli.net/2021/07/19/9KM8suDJWZI2UX4.png)

3. 京东

京东是一款基于HTML5的应用。该应用实现了各类商品的查询、购买、收藏等功能。

![jingdong](https://i.loli.net/2021/07/19/FrVm84i7MT3WwpO.png)

4. 58同城

58同城是一款基于HTML5的应用。该应用实现了租房、买房、二手物品交易、招聘等各方面的功能。

![58tongcheng](https://i.loli.net/2021/07/19/xKM5OpveRiq3zjb.png)

#### HTML5开发应用的主要工具

1. Brackets

Brackets是一个轻量级的HTML编辑器。它具有实时预览、实时代码高亮、实时CSS预处理、便捷的扩展等特点。

![brackets](https://i.loli.net/2021/07/19/P5Kbl9zDUnW8xav.png)

2. Appery.io

Appery.io是一个基于云计算的HTML5开发工具,它可以帮助开发人员快速构建移动应用程序原型、设置该应用的UI以及添加业务逻辑。

![appery.io](https://i.loli.net/2021/07/19/y1JWVQd3kNvleJu.png)

3. Sencha Touch

Sencha Touch是一个用于构建HTML5应用程序的框架,它可以让开发人员使用JavaScript实现跨平台应用程序的开发。

![sencha touch](https://i.loli.net/2021/07/19/aDsCqgfWVLX4ATc.png)

4. jQuery Mobile

jQuery Mobile是一个基于jQuery UI的框架,可以通过简单的HTML标记实现跨平台应用程序的开发。

![jquery mobile](https://i.loli.net/2021/07/19/7XH9GN2urnWemct.png)

HTML5技术的应用范围逐渐化广,其实现的应用也越来越成熟,未来HTML5将进一步发展壮大,成为移动应用开发的重要工具。


相关知识:
淘宝app是h5封装吗
淘宝app是基于h5技术进行封装的。它使用了前端技术的“混合开发”方式,将Web技术与Native技术融合在一起,实现了淘宝app的开发。具体来说,淘宝app在开发中采用了以下技术:1. WebView技术淘宝app采用了WebView技术来实现页面渲染。
2023-05-26
临汾h5开发app
临汾H5开发App是一种基于HTML5技术的移动应用开发方式,有着很高的可移植性、兼容性和跨平台特性。下面就详细介绍一下。一、 HTML5技术简介HTML5技术是HTML最新的标准版本,被认为是Web应用开发的未来发展方向。HTML5技术具有以下主要特点:
2023-05-26
红包游戏制作app开发搭建h5
红包游戏是一种非常流行的线上社交活动,它能够以一定的方式将人们联系在一起,提高社交交流的效果。现在,越来越多的人们都在参与这种游戏,所以开发一个红包游戏APP或者H5平台应运而生。本文将介绍红包游戏APP或H5平台开发的原理或者详细介绍。一、红包游戏APP
2023-05-25
h5原生app封装教程
随着移动互联网的快速发展,很多企业都希望能够在手机端推出自己的产品或服务。H5原生App封装技术,就成为了一种非常流行的解决方案。封装完的App不仅可以将网页体验带到手机上,而且相比于纯H5应用,具有更好的性能和用户体验。下面我将详细介绍H5原生App封装
2023-05-25
h5移动端开发app如何下载至手机
移动端开发的app可以下载安装在手机上,让用户可以更方便地使用。对于h5移动端开发的app,它们的下载方式和原理与原生应用不尽相同。以下是一个关于如何下载h5移动端开发的app至手机的详细介绍。1. 下载前端代码首先,开发者需要按照常规的方式开发前端代码。
2023-05-25
h5页面软件制作app
HTML5技术是目前非常流行和广泛应用的技术之一,它可以用于网站开发和移动应用程序开发,同时还可以跨平台使用,因此非常受到欢迎。在移动应用程序开发领域,HTML5应用程序也被称为“H5应用程序”,它不需要依靠特定的平台,而只需要通过浏览器来运行。在移动应用
2023-05-25
h5免费在线封装app
随着智能手机和移动互联网的普及,越来越多的企业和个人希望能够推出自己的APP。但是对于开发APP的门槛比较高,需要懂得编程等技术,因此很多人会选择使用在线封装工具来实现简单的APP制作。其中比较常见的就是基于H5技术的免费在线封装APP工具。H5作为一种基
2023-05-25
h5封装app卡
随着移动互联网的发展,APP已经成为人们日常生活中不可或缺的一部分。但是,对于一些中小企业或个人开发者来说,想要开发一个全新的APP需要付出很高的成本,因此,使用h5封装成APP在一定程度上成为了一种相对低成本的解决方案。那么,h5封装APP卡是怎么实现的
2023-05-25
h5打包的app对接微信支付接口是什么
H5打包的APP是基于HTML5技术开发出来的,其本质还是一个网页应用,只是通过打包成原生APP的方式来进行发布和安装。微信支付是一种可以直接在移动设备上完成支付的移动支付方式,是通过微信支付接口来实现的。在H5打包的APP中,对接微信支付接口需要以下几个
2023-05-25
h5打包app还会跨域吗
H5(指基于HTML5标准开发的网页)可以通过打包成App的方式获得更好的用户体验,而且更容易推广和传播,不过在这个过程中,由于涉及到跨域问题,会导致一定的困扰。本文将详细介绍H5打包成App之后仍然会出现跨域问题的原因及其解决方法。一、跨域问题的定义我们
2023-05-25
app中做h5页面的缓存优化
移动应用可以内置网页,也可以通过 webview 加载网页,使用 webview 加载网页相对于内置网页更加灵活,但是相对于本地编写的页面加载速度会慢一些,同时因为网络状况原因已经常会出现加载失败、服务器宕机等问题,因此做好缓存优化显得尤为重要。本文将介绍
2023-05-25
app h5打包生成
App H5打包生成是指将基于H5技术的网页应用程序(Web App)通过一系列工具和技术,将其转化为可以在移动设备上运行的原生应用程序(Native App)。通过App H5打包生成,可以使得开发者在开发和发布App方面更加灵活和高效。App H5打包
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3